Taking a closer look, the interrupts for CPUs 2 and 3 here are clearly wrong since they already belong to some audio controllers in the DTSI. I looked up documentation and found an S905D3 manual from Khadas which documents SPI 137 (GIC interrupt 169) as "|PMUIRQ_a[3:0]", which I can't read as anything other than "logical OR of all 4 PMU IRQs". Not sure about SPI 138 but I'd guess it's something that just happens to fire in a manner that appears to sort of work for the PMU.

Sadly it looks like Neil's instinct was right and this one is also in fact dead, sorry :(

A fairly solid test would be to run a sampling event (e.g. `perf stat`)
taskset to a single CPU and observe the corresponding IRQ count increase
in /proc/interrupts, for each core in turn. If that behaves as expected
then chances are everything is indeed sane.

Couple of nitpicks for the patch itself - you're almost there, but
you've got spurious tabs on the blank lines, plus you need a proper
commit message and your sign-off above the "---" line - anything you add
below there is treated as additional commentary for reviewers' benefit
and will be discarded by `git am`.

If SM1 actually has distinct per-core interrupts as the patch implies
then it's fine - it's only G12B and anything else that combines multiple
PMU IRQs into a single SPI which are unsupportable.
